Assuming you are talking about an ultrasonic fogger, please don't run it in the tank. These devices will drive your fish insane, if not kill them. To understand the power of these devices, put it in a bowl of tapwater, turn it on and stick your finger in the emitter where the fog comes from. It will hurt, bad. I find it hard to believe an aquarium supplies retailer would consider doing such a thing.

Not to mention it probably won't work in saltwater. If you want the "effect" put it in a bowl of RO water on top of the tank. The fog itself won't hurt anything.

In all seriousness, an ultrasonic one would be fine in the house, but I'd be careful with the ones that use the jugs of "juice" to make the fog. I used to work around those all the time. They make your lungs and nasal passages feel like they are coated with film after a while. I can't imagine it would be too good for a tank.
